The Balanced Scorecard

Managers today need to look past traditional viewpoints in determining the success of their company's strategy. One such approach is known as the balanced scorecard. This approach involves looking past just one measure and involves taking a comprehensive view of the organization. This is a useful tool for new managers to understand and add to their "toolbox" of management expertise.

The balanced scorecard give managers a quick and comprehensive view of organizational performance using four primary indicators: customer satisfaction, internal processes, innovation and improvement activities, and financial measures. This "scorecard" is visually represented on a strategy map.
